What is the Boustany MBA Harvard Scholarship?

The Boustany MBA Harvard Scholarship is a highly competitive, merit-based financial aid program offered once every two years to a single, exceptional candidate admitted to Harvard Business School. Established by the Boustany Foundation, the initiative aims to discover, nurture, and empower future leaders who demonstrate not only academic brilliance but also a profound potential to drive international cooperation and cross-cultural understanding.

The Boustany Foundation itself was founded in 2006 by Nabil Boustany and his son Fadi. With active presences in Switzerland and Monaco, the foundation focuses on funding educational opportunities and driving projects that contribute to the betterment of humanity. By partnering with Harvard University, the foundation ensures that financial constraints do not prevent the world’s sharpest minds from accessing world-class business training.

Because this scholarship is only awarded once every two years, it is considered one of the most exclusive and prestigious business school fellowships globally.

Core Benefits: What Does the Scholarship Cover?

The Boustany Foundation has structured this program to offer extensive financial relief, allowing the recipient to focus entirely on their academic performance and leadership development. The financial and professional perks are broken down below:

1. Significant Tuition Fee Reduction

The primary benefit of the scholarship is that it covers 75% of the total tuition fees at Harvard Business School. Given that HBS tuition costs tens of thousands of dollars per year, this subsidy effectively eliminates three-quarters of the baseline academic invoice, making an Ivy League degree vastly more accessible.

2. Fully Funded Monaco Internship

The scholar is required to complete a two-month, unpaid internship at the Boustany Foundation’s official headquarters in Monaco. While the internship itself is unpaid, the foundation comprehensively covers all associated operational costs:

  • Travel Expenses: Return flights and travel arrangements from Harvard University to Monaco.
  • Accommodation: Fully covered lodging for the entire duration of the two-month stay.
  • Living Allowance: Food and daily living expenses related to the internship are fully provided.

The Highlight: The Boustany Foundation Internship in Monaco

The true differentiator of the Harvard University MBA Scholarship 2027 is the mandatory two-month summer internship in the Principality of Monaco. This component transforms the award from a standard financial grant into an experiential career accelerator.

What to Expect During the Internship

During the summer break between their first and second year of MBA studies, the selected scholar travels to Monaco. The foundation designs projects to match the scholar’s specific professional profile, background, and personal interests. Typical initiatives include:

  • Developing and proposing new global scholarship branches.
  • Creating strategic awareness and marketing campaigns for the foundation’s humanitarian goals.
  • Collaborating with the foundation’s international partners on ongoing socio-economic developments.

This immersive experience allows the scholar to step out of the academic bubble and apply high-level business frameworks directly to real-world philanthropic challenges. Furthermore, spending two months in Monaco provides unparalleled networking opportunities with high-net-worth individuals, global policymakers, and non-profit executives.

Eligibility Criteria for the 2027 Intake

Because the Boustany Foundation invests heavily in its chosen scholar, the selection criteria are intentionally rigorous. To be considered for the 2027 cycle, applicants must meet the following baseline requirements:

  • Global Openness: The scholarship is open to students of all nationalities. There are no geographic restrictions on who can apply.
  • Lebanese Descent Priority: While open to the world, the foundation gives special priority and preference to qualified candidates of Lebanese descent.
  • Academic Excellence: Applicants must possess an outstanding academic track record, displaying top-tier performance in their undergraduate studies and prior professional endeavors.
  • Leadership Promise: Candidates must show considerable potential, a clear future trajectory, and a commitment to creating positive global impacts.
  • Language Proficiency: A flawless command of the English language is mandatory, as it is the sole medium of instruction at Harvard Business School.
  • Pre-requisite HBS Admission: You cannot apply for the scholarship until you have successfully navigated the standard application process for Harvard Business School and received an official, unconditional offer of admission.

⚠️ Critical Notice for Applicants: The Boustany Foundation strictly ignores scholarship applications from individuals who have not yet been accepted into the Harvard MBA program. Securing your seat at HBS is your absolute first priority.

Required Documentation

When submitting your candidacy to the Boustany Foundation, you must package your application materials professionally. Ensure you have clean, updated digital copies of the following documents ready:

  1. Comprehensive Curriculum Vitae (CV): A detailed resume highlighting your academic achievements, employment history, leadership roles, and extracurricular milestones.
  2. Professional Photograph: A high-quality, professional headshot.
  3. Official GMAT Scores: Proof of your Graduate Management Admission Test (GMAT) results, which reflect your analytical and quantitative aptitude.
  4. Harvard Acceptance Letter: The official, verified letter of admission issued to you by the Harvard Business School admissions committee.

Can I apply for the Boustany Scholarship before getting accepted into Harvard?

No. The Boustany Foundation will automatically reject any application that does not include an official acceptance letter from Harvard Business School.

Does the scholarship cover 100% of my expenses?

No. The scholarship covers 75% of tuition fees alongside full travel, lodging, and food costs specifically for the summer internship in Monaco. Students must self-fund or find alternative loans/grants for the remaining 25% of tuition, as well as their general living expenses while staying in Boston.

Is the two-month internship in Monaco mandatory?

Yes. The internship is an absolute requirement of accepting the scholarship award. The foundation coordinates travel and accommodation to make this transition seamless.

Do I have to be of Lebanese descent to win?

Not at all. The scholarship is explicitly open to applicants of all nationalities. While priority is given to candidates of Lebanese origin, non-Lebanese candidates with exceptional merit and potential are frequently selected.
